In case of HPLC coloums what is the difference Between C8 &
C18 coloums & how can we select difference type of coloums
like Inertial ODS , Hypersil BDS , ODS etc.?
Answer Posted / pharmainterview
C8- C8 Carbon chain is attached to silica
c18- C18 Carbon chain is attached to silica.
There are many manufacturer who will prepare c8 or c18
column. Even though the basic concept is same for all,
there are some differences like
1.pore size
2.particle size
3.free silanol
4.end capping
5.silica purity etc
Based on our sample properties and suitability we can selct
a column after different trials.
